University of the Potomac-Washington DC Campus

University of the Potomac-Washington DC Campus (referred to as the Potomac-Washington DC Campus) is a Private, 4-years school located in Washington, DC. It is classified as School of business and management school by Carnegie Classification and its highest level of offering is Doctor's degree - research/scholarship.
The 2023 tuition & fees at University of the Potomac-Washington DC Campus is $6,660. The school has a total enrollment of 534 and students to faculty ratio is 7.14% (14 to 1).

Who Accredits University of the Potomac-Washington DC Campus

University of the Potomac-Washington DC Campus is accredited by Middle States Commission on Higher Education (7/1/2006 - Current[Estimated Date]).

The undergraduate tuition & fees at the Potomac-Washington DC Campus is $6,660 for the academic year 2022-2023. The graduate tuition & fees at the Potomac-Washington DC Campus is $5,850 for the academic year 2022-2023.
the Potomac-Washington DC Campus offers the alternative tuition plans. 37% of enrolled students have received grants and/or scholarships and the average amount of received financial aid is $1,510 (exclude student loans).

the Potomac-Washington DC Campus offers the distance education programs that all courses for completing a degree program can be done through online exclusively for undergraduate and graduate programs. In addition, the distance learning courses are offered for students who are not enrolled online exclusively.
the Potomac-Washington DC Campus offers weekend/evening college program.
